I think that I've lucked out with my chapter as far as horrible t-shirts...our worst one I'm actually wearing right now...my rush shirt for my pledge class.

Really it's not too bad...just boring. Navy shirt with Beta Theta Pi in greek letters in a light blue on the front left breast...below that in orange is alpha tau (our chapter)spelled out. On the back is a huge lower case b in that same weird light blue underlined in orange...and in white running verticle to the edge of the b it says Recruitment 2001 and underneath everything Beta Theta pi is spelled out.

Our best t-shirt was for an annual party thrown by the years' pledge class for the active chapter. This was for the party thrown by my pledge class. It was black shirt and in white on the front, in the same font used for The Sopranos (along with little pistol "r") it said BILTMORE and below that "Beta. Fiji." in smaller print. On the back centered at the top of the shirt (right in the neck area) it had the logo from "The Godfather" (the hand with the marionette strings) but it had Beta Theta Pi in greek letters in place of 'The Godfather'...really cool shirt that everyone has just loved. (not to mention it was a fabulous party)

The best t-shirt I think I've seen was one used by the Beta chapter at U of Minnesota... front was the BMW logo, but instead of BMW it had Beta Theta Pi in greek letters, and it said "the ultimate fraternity experience" on the back it had the Minnesota license plate and said BETA-RUSH as the 'personalization'
